Dawn (Al-Fajr)
In the name of Allah, the Beneficent, the Merciful
I swear by the daybreak, 1 and the ten nights! 2 And the Even and the Odd, 3 by the night when it journeys on! 4 Truly in that there is an oath for those who possess understanding. 5 Hast thou not seen how thy Lord did with Ad, 6 Iram of the pillars, 7 the like of which has never been created in the land, 8 And how did He deal with Thamud who hewed out rocks in the valley? 9 And (with) Fir'aun (Pharaoh), who had pegs (who used to torture men by binding them to pegs)? 10 (All) these transgressed beyond bounds in the lands, 11 and exceeded in corruption therein. 12 Wherefore thy Lord poured on them the scourge of His torment. 13 Indeed nothing is hidden from the sight of your Lord. 14 As for man, when his Lord tests him, through honour and blessings, he says, "My Lord has honoured me," 15 But when He tests him by straitening his sustenance, he says: “My Lord has humiliated me.” 16 Nay, but ye (for your part) honour not the orphan 17 and you urge not the feeding of the needy, 18 And ye devour heritages with devouring greed. 19 And love wealth with all your heart. 20 No indeed! When the earth is ground to powder, 21 and your Lord comes with the angels, rank upon rank, 22 and Gehenna is brought out, upon that day man will remember; and how shall the Reminder be for him? 23 He will say, "Would that I had done some good deeds for this life". 24 For, that Day, His Chastisement will be such as none (else) can inflict, 25 And none will bind as He will bind. 26 O the contented soul! 27 return unto thy Lord, well-pleased, well-pleasing! 28 Join My worshipers and 29 Enter thou My Garden! 30
